Read the following information carefully to answer the questions that follow.
(i) P+Q means 'P is the father of Q'.
(ii) PQ means 'P is the mother of Q'
(iii) P×Q means 'P is the brother of Q'.
(iv) P÷Q means 'P is the sister of Q'.
Which of the following means 'H is the paternal grandfather of T'?
